Default .30 carbine revolver N frame 8 shot...

I know Ruger made a single action in 30 carbine a while ago..they still might? But why no DA revolvers in 30 carbine? It's a very strong cartridge,producing almost 2k. feet per second with a 110grain bullet. Granted,these velocities are out of a long barrel,but still,I'm sure it would make a great handgun cartridge. Ammo is aplenty,in mixed varieties. What I would like is an N frame, 6" barrel with 7 or 8 rounds. Price it right..I'd buy at least one..

In a revolver-length barrel like the Ruger Blackhawk, the .30 Carbine round is LOUD!!!! Not a very pleasant plinking round. I think more modern rounds designed for the revolver, like the .32 H&R and .327 Magnums, cover that ballistic niche in more usable packages.

You may be aware that S&W made some test N frame guns in .30 Carbine in WWII, but they went nowhere as there was usually always a better answer to any question asked.
